In the early 2000s, at the top of her game and under contract with NIKE as a Global Elite Athlete, Director of a top health club in California, and in-demand working with companies like Reebok, Sketchers, YogaWorks, and Equinox she was also severely bulimic, overworked and exhausted. She cracked.When the illusion came crashing down she woke up to something extremely powerful and liberating: the Groove Truths. From here she launched her global company The World Groove Movement and shares her story and passion for movement, inspiring millions to come together and get their Groove on! He serves as the CEO of the boutique future-proofing consultancy Disaster Avoidance Experts, which specializes in helping forward-looking leaders avoid dangerous threats and missed opportunities. A best-selling author, he wrote Never Go With Your Gut: How Pioneering Leaders Make the Best Decisions and Avoid Business Disasters (Career Press, 2019), The Blindspots Between Us: How to Overcome Unconscious Cognitive Bias and Build Better Relationships (New Harbinger Press, 2020), and Resilience: Adapt and Plan for the New Abnormal of the COVID-19 Coronavirus Pandemic (Changemakers Books, 2020). His writing was translated into Chinese, Korean, German, Russian, Polish, and other languages. His cutting-edge thought leadership was featured in over 550 articles and 450 interviews in prominent venues. They include Fortune, USA Today, Fast Company, CBS News, CNBC, Time, Business Insider, Government Executive, The Chronicle of Philanthropy, CNBC, and Inc. Magazine. His expertise comes from over 20 years of consulting, coaching, and speaking, and training for mid-size and large organizations ranging from Aflac to Xerox.
